Chopard's Cave-cricket

Chopard's Cave Cricket (Dolichopoda chopardi) is a camel cricket or cave cricket in the family Rhaphidophoridae, found in cave systems and subterranean environments of the western Mediterranean region, including areas of southern France, northern Italy, and possibly adjacent territories. Cave crickets of the genus Dolichopoda are obligate or near-obligate cave dwellers (troglobionts or troglophiles), characterised by their extreme leg elongation — particularly the hind legs and antennae, which are several times longer than the body — reduced eyes or eyelessness, lack of wings, and depigmented or pale yellowish-brown body colouration. These adaptations reflect evolutionary response to permanent cave darkness. Dolichopoda cave crickets feed as omnivores on organic detritus, bat guano, fungi, and invertebrates carried into cave systems by water or wind. They are sensitive bio-indicators of cave ecosystem health. The species is named in honour of Lucien Chopard, a French entomologist. The IUCN classifies this species as Data Deficient, reflecting limited survey data on its distribution and population status across cave systems within its range. Cave-dwelling invertebrates face threats from groundwater pollution, cave tourism impacts, changes in cave hydrology, and the spread of white-nose syndrome affecting bat populations whose guano provides food resources.

Chungan Sucker Frog

The Chungan Sucker Frog (Amolops chunganensis) is a Least Concern torrent frog in the family Ranidae, endemic to central China, particularly associated with the mountains of Chongqing (formerly Chungan County, from which the species name derives) and surrounding areas. The genus Amolops, commonly known as torrent frogs or cascade frogs, is adapted for life in and around fast-flowing mountain streams, with expanded toe pads and sucker-like discs that allow clinging to wet, smooth rock surfaces in high-velocity water. Breeding occurs in stream environments, where males call from boulders at the stream edge and larvae develop in oxygenated torrent pools with specialized mouthparts for adhering to rock substrates. A. chunganensis inhabits subtropical and montane forests at elevations ranging from low to mid altitudes in Sichuan and Chongqing. The IUCN assesses this species as Least Concern, reflecting a relatively wide distribution within suitable stream habitats across central China. However, it faces ongoing pressure from water quality degradation, dam construction and stream modification, deforestation, and pollution from agricultural and urban runoff. Amolops frogs are sensitive to siltation and chemical contamination of breeding streams.
